THE standard for smart metering DLMS Device Language Message Specification COSEM: Companion Specification for Energy Metering OBIS: Object Identification System All energy types, all applications, all communication media First published in 1998: high end >> low end applications IEC 62056 standard since 2002 : Ed. 4 in 2015, Ed. 5 in 2016 Large smart meter rollouts worldwide Supported by the DLMS User Association: 300+ members 562 meter types certified to 80+ manufacturers Okos Jövő DLMS Slide No: 3

E2E security Access security, messsage security, data security Several protection layers can be applied by market participant, client, server Authentication (Integrity), encryption (Confidentiality), digital signature (Non-repudiation) Protection can be applied selectively where needed
Efficiency Selective access: get only what you need Eliminate overhead: Compact data Many data with one request: with-list Message length fits media: segmentation Compression Push and pull operation Objectives: meet media specific restrictions, minimize overhead and number of round trips >> minimize costs Okos Jövő DLMS Slide No: 8

DLMS User Association: www.dlms.com Who we are Community of users of DLMS/COSEM standard Non-profit Association registered in Zug, Switzerland IEC and CENELEC partner 300+ members from 50+ countries (6 from Hungary) 450+ DLMS/COSEM compliant meter types What do we do development input to international standardization conformance certification promotion support and training Okos Jövő DLMS Slide No: 16
